MHA issues notice to Rahul Gandhi on complaint questioning 'British citizenship'
Ministry of Home Affairs (MHA) has issued a notice to Congress President Rahul Gandhi to clarify his nationality within a fortnight after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) MP Subramanian Swamy alleged that he is a British national.
The MHA in a letter dated April 29, said that Gandhi has declared his nationality as British in an annual return filed by a British company named Backops Ltd.
The Ministry sought the Congress President's response over the issue within 14 days.
